8000 ShayanTheNerd (Shayan Zamani) · GitHub
[go: up one dir, main page]

Skip to content
View ShayanTheNerd's full-sized avatar
💻
Coding & Learning
💻
Coding & Learning

Highlights

  • Pro

Organizations

@Rabits-Solutions

Block or report ShayanTheNerd

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
ShayanTheNerd/README.md

Hi there! I’m Shayan, a freelance front-end web developer with over 4 years of experience in creating seamless user interfaces and fine-tuning website performance. I’m passionate about contributing to open-source projects, love learning new things, and enjoy sharing knowledge with fellow developers.

Skills

Languages

Markdown, SVG, HTML, CSS, SCSS, JavaScript, and TypeScript

Technologies

TailwindCSS, UnoCSS, Astro, Vue, Nuxt, Supabase, and REST APIs

Testing Frameworks

Storybook, Vitest, Cypress, and Playwright

Other Tools

VS Code, Git, GitHub, GitHub Actions, Netlify, NPM, Bun, Vite, Prettier, and ESLint

Pinned Loading

  1. eslint-config eslint-config Public

    Modern and flexible ESLint config

    TypeScript 6

  2. image-editor image-editor Public

    Easily edit your images in just a few clicks.

    Astro 16 2

  3. IP-address-tracker IP-address-tracker Public

    Simply track the geographical location of any IP address.

    JavaScript 2

  4. vuejs/eslint-plugin-vue vuejs/eslint-plugin-vue Public

    Official ESLint plugin for Vue.js

    JavaScript 4.6k 689

  5. hail2u/html-best-practices hail2u/html-best-practices Public

    For writing maintainable and scalable HTML documents

    4.1k 435

  6. Git commit message template Git commit message template
    1
    # ====================================== Template =======================================
    2
    # <type>[(scope)][!]: <summary> (maximum 50 characters)
    3
    
                  
    4
    # [body]: Explain WHY you are making this change, not HOW. (wrap lines at 72 characters)
    5
    
                  
0